Academic Pharmacy Fellow - School of Pharmacy

 

Position Summary

MCW School of Pharmacy is seeking applications for an Academic Fellow. This individual will be appointed as a full-time, year-round non-tenure track Clinical Instructor.

This position is a 2-year post-graduate opportunity, designed to prepare pharmacists for a career in pharmacy education through training in teaching, curriculum development, college service, mentoring, scholarship and clinical practice with an anticipated start date of 8/1/2026. Individuals that have completed PGY1 or PGY2 training program can apply for a one-year fellowship.

The clinical responsibilities of the fellow will be consistent with experiences provided in a PGY1 residency. The fellows will be exposed to a variety of teaching responsibilities, including lecturing, facilitating small group-based learning, course coordination and student assessment. In addition to extensive academic experience, the fellows will also participate in direct patient-care rotations in primary care. This position reports to the Academic Fellowship Director in the School of Pharmacy.

The training year will consist of approximately 60% teaching- and academic-related duties and 40% clinical practice. Highlights of the training program include participating for the entire year on a college committee, extensive teaching experience and flexible clinical practice opportunities. At the end of the training program, academic fellows will be well prepared for a career in academia.

Select Fellowship Activities - Teaching and College Service

  • Design, implement, facilitate, and deliver innovative educational content within the Doctor of Pharmacy program

  • Develop skills in educational training through a variety of classroom experiences (i.e. didactic lecturing, facilitating skills labs, and small group active-learning environments)

  • Participate in a longitudinal specialty area of academia (i.e. Assessment, Curriculum, Admissions, Faculty Affairs, etc.)

  • Develop skills necessary for successful course coordination, precept Introductory and/or Advanced Pharmacy Practice students on clinical rotations

  • Engage in mentorship activities through student organizations and community service

  • Exhibit professionalism through participation in pharmacy and interprofessional organizations and serving as student organization mentor

  • Complete the MCW School of Pharmacy Teaching Certificate Program

  • Complete the MCW Kinetic 3 Teaching Academy

  • Precept students in a clinical telehealth program

Scholarship

  • Complete the MCW School of Pharmacy Research Certificate Program

  • Complete a research project related to the scholarship of teaching, learning and/or education

  • Present research data at a professional meeting and the Annual MCW School of Pharmacy Research Symposium annually

  • Submit paper for publication (systemic review, educational innovation, etc.)

  • Represent the college at selected professional meetings (regional and national presence)

  • Submission of a grant proposal will be taught and is highly encouraged

Clinical Practice

  • Refine clinical practice skills by maintaining clinical practice skills and providing patient-centered care in a specialty of fellow’s choice (ambulatory care, internal medicine, cardiology, etc.)

  • Develop pharmacy practice experience and expertise in support of the clinical knowledge expected of a faculty member

  • Coordinate and participate in health fairs and population health initiatives
